Handover note — Parcelwise webhook

Taking over from Dario: the parcel-tracking webhook on Crateline now retries failed deliveries three times with exponential backoff. Dead-letter events land in the holding queue and get replayed nightly. New folks: check signature validation first when carriers report missing scans; it fails silently if the secret rotates. The service reads its settings at boot, listed below.

settings of bawif-fawif:
ralix:
  log_level: warn
  metrics_host: metrics.ralix.tolvaqsys.internal
  pool_size: 32

Dark-mode support in the Lanterndesk admin dashboard is controlled per environment. The THEME_DEFAULT and THEME_ALLOW_TOGGLE flags ship in the base config, but the themed asset bundle is served from the Mossgate CDN, which requires a signed fetch. Palette overrides live in themes/dusk.json and need no restart; the CDN credential does. For the Thursday sync: staging already has this set. Append the signing secret on the following line.

sealed setting: ARCHIVE_KEY3=8d0

## Build Provenance: Marrowbase Profile Shard Migration

Each shard of the Marrowbase user-profile store is cut by a deterministic migration tool, and every shard manifest is signed at build time. Reviewers should verify that the manifest hash matches the attestation recorded in the provenance ledger before approving rollout. The attestation chain for this migration terminates at the build listed immediately below.

pipeline stamp: htk9_ce63042d9